FEMALE REBEL COLLECTION
FEMALE REBEL BEGAN AS A PAINTING EXERCISE.
I SET OUT TO EXPLORE THE EXPRESSIVE POSSIBILITIES OF A SINGLE COLOUR, CURIOUS TO SEE HOW FAR I COULD GO WITHIN A DELIBERATELY LIMITED PALETTE. SOMEWHERE ALONG THE WAY, I REALISED I WAS NO LONGER STUDYING RED.
WITHOUT PLANNING IT, THE WORK BECAME AN EXPLORATION OF THE FEMALE CONDITION - SHAPED BY THE WOMEN I HAD BEEN READING, LISTENING TO, AND THINKING ABOUT.
WHAT BEGAN AS A STUDY OF ONE COLOUR BECAME A STUDY OF WOMANHOOD.

Part of the Female Rebel series, this original abstract painting explores strength as something complex rather than absolute.
Built through multiple translucent layers of deep crimson, burgundy, and near-black tones, the work moves between concealment and revelation. Broad gestures remain visible beneath the surface, creating a sense of movement that feels both deliberate and instinctive.
What began as an exploration of a single colour gradually evolved into a reflection on resilience, contradiction, and the many versions of ourselves that coexist beneath the surface.
